  • ### Dripping Slime

Sticky orange slime drips from the gigantic (40′ tall) antler fungi that dominate this hex. Before long, travellers are coated in the stuff.

Wiping off: The slime is so sticky that it is almost impossible to wipe off, except with the aid of an acidic liquid (e.g. wine, vinegar). The slime naturally rubs off over the course of several days.

Consuming: Those bold enough to taste the slime find it surprisingly tasty, with a sweet, nutty flavour. Consuming a large volume (at least a cup full) cures Hit Points (maximum once a day), but causes the character’s mouth to become so gummed up that they are unable to speak clearly for hours (this prevents spell casting).

Harvesting: If collected, the slime loses its healing potency after days. Each dose is worth 50gp.

The Fungal Chasm

A great chasm, 100 yards deep and nearly 4 miles long, runs north–south through the central regions of this hex. Its sheer sides are clad with hand-like fronds of cyan and violet lichen, dotted with small crevices in which tiny glow worms nest.

At the bottom: The base of the chasm is a lightless avenue of rich, black soil, creeping worms, and sprawling mounds of yellow and orange ear-shaped fungi.

Travel in the chasm: Following the natural path of the chasm, characters can travel north or south through this hex (to 1604 or 1606) with no chance of getting lost.

Holbies

1′ tall, incorporeal, translucent humanoid mushrooms that glow a lambent green or yellow. Holbies have bendy, jointless limbs and bulbous mushroom caps in place of heads.

Demeanour (Neutral): Curious, playful.

Speech: Silent tittering. Appear to understand Sylvan, but do not speak.

Desires: To observe travellers and witness the natural beauty of the fungal forest.

Small Fungus—Sentient—Neutral

Level 1 AC 10 HP (2) Saves R13 H14 B15 S16 Att None Speed 20 Fly 20 Morale 5 XP 20

Immunities: Only harmed by magic or magic weapons.

Vanish: Can disappear into a mysterious parallel dimension at will.

Inhabitants: The chasm is home to hundreds of diminutive fungal humanoids called holbies. Travellers in the chasm attract an ever-growing following of the curious creatures.

Encounters: While PCs travel in the chasm, any creatures encountered are 3-in likely to be above the party, at the top of the chasm.

Eating the lichen: It tastes horribly bitter and is mildly poisonous: Save Versus Doom or suffer fits of vomiting for hours (–2 to Attack Rolls and Saving Throws).
